Transaction 803008772878702fcc53668a1fd68d6eea23946037e437c8c807d8f08aec34a9
1 Input
1 Output
-
803008772878702fcc53668a1fd68d6eea23946037e437c8c807d8f08aec34a9:0
- value
- 30746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6aecebda82a6816d2455190917097c6bf477218d OP_EQUAL
- address
- 3BSPNTYeCGQf9u2JvSsuieeQNgay5CxztL